How they compare

United Republic of Tanzania currently reports 0.7876 kg CO2eq/kg against 0.6905 kg CO2eq/kg in Timor-Leste, a difference of 0.0971 kg CO2eq/kg.

That makes United Republic of Tanzania's figure about 1.1 times Timor-Leste's.

Across all 63 years both countries report, United Republic of Tanzania has been ahead every year.

Timor-Leste ranks 12th and United Republic of Tanzania ranks 11th of 20 countries.

United Republic of Tanzania has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Timor-Leste United Republic of Tanzania Difference Ahead
1960s 0.6706 kg CO2eq/kg 2.68 kg CO2eq/kg 2.01 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
1970s 0.6659 kg CO2eq/kg 2.37 kg CO2eq/kg 1.7 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
1980s 0.6736 kg CO2eq/kg 2.23 kg CO2eq/kg 1.55 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
1990s 0.7017 kg CO2eq/kg 1.01 kg CO2eq/kg 0.3123 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
2000s 0.7114 kg CO2eq/kg 0.8718 kg CO2eq/kg 0.1604 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
2010s 0.6579 kg CO2eq/kg 0.8405 kg CO2eq/kg 0.1826 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ania
2020s 0.5855 kg CO2eq/kg 0.7876 kg CO2eq/kg 0.2021 kg CO2eq/kg United Republic of Tanzania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ions intensities contains analytical data on the intensity of gre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by agricultural commodity. This indicator is defined as greenhouse gas emissions per kg of product. Data are available for a set of agricultural commodities (e.g. rice and other cereals, meat, milk, eggs), by country, with global coverage.
